Hi Nancy, I am Herlean, in Ohio. Married, mother of one. I know that different areas charge various prices.
For example, gas prices are higher at the same chain if they are located closer to the highway exit. Go a mile or two into town and the gas drops a few cents a gallon. It has made the news that grocery stores charge and even stock different items in different areas.
